As stated above I now know that the Yellow with black tracer is choke, so I tested it with a tester and it lit up fine!

So I hooked it up and stil nothing??

I went back to the motor and looked around to find that the wire rotted off the selnoid.

I striped it back and told my son to push the key while I held the wire to the screw, I hear the choke click!
I added a new connector and screwed it on.

went up turn the key pushed choke just turned? I pushed the warm up leaver up a bit turned the key pushed the key for choke and Bam started right up!

Seacrets 10-02-2007 04:25 PM

Re: So I screwed up the ignition wires
 
If you adjust for a list on the starboard side (either bow up or down) your port tab makes the adjustment not the starboard tab. If you push starboard switch it operates the port tab and vise versa. All you have to remember is, if you want an adjustment for the starboard side, use the starboard switch. See their instruction manual (pg 2). Mj, I think you selected the best tab.
